fixed bug in mouse handling

git-svn-id: https://svn.wxwidgets.org/svn/wx/wxWidgets/branches/WX_2_2_BRANCH@8336 c3d73ce0-8a6f-49c7-b76d-6d57e0e08775
This commit is contained in:
Vadim Zeitlin
2000-09-12 08:29:02 +00:00
parent 6c35149269
commit 95e98de61b

View File

@@ -2305,7 +2305,9 @@ void wxTreeCtrl::OnMouse( wxMouseEvent &event )
nevent.SetEventObject(this);
GetEventHandler()->ProcessEvent(nevent);
}
else if ( event.LeftUp() && m_lastOnSame )
else if ( event.LeftUp() )
{
if ( m_lastOnSame )
{
if ( (item == m_current) &&
(flags & wxTREE_HITTEST_ONITEMLABEL) &&
@@ -2316,6 +2318,7 @@ void wxTreeCtrl::OnMouse( wxMouseEvent &event )
m_lastOnSame = FALSE;
}
}
else
{
if ( event.LeftDown() )